John Duport (died 1617) was an English scholar and translator.
Dr John Duport was born in Shepshed in Leicestershire.
[1] In 1583, he became rector of Fulham, and in 1585, precentor of St Paul's Cathedral.
[1] He served as Director of the "Second Cambridge Company" charged by James I of England with translating parts the Apocrypha for the King James Version of the Bible.
